abs, average_pool_2d, cat, ceil and clamp
mapping to TOSA operators
ABS, ARGMAX, AVG_POOL2D, CAT, CEIL, CLAMP

Required refactoring some serialization going
through numpy since numpy doesn't have native
support of bfloat16. Where possible, avoid
dtype handling all together by viewing as uint8.
In process node, make a special case for bf16
and use ml_dtypes.
